  • @STINKFISHcompany The higher divisions are a bit harder. But if you've successfully done a 16 by 16 version, I believe you should be ok. The folding is the same (just a bit more of it), collapsing may be a bit trickier to start with because you need to get more creases pointing all in the right direction.

  • What exactly is a tessellation? I mean I've never even heard of that? Is it for decoration? Is it like a base for somethin? It looks great don't get me wrong.. I just have no idea what it is.

  • @Dillon594209 It's a pattern that you can repeat over and over. As to what you make of it, whatever you like. You may want to fold a tessellation resembling scales to then fold a fish or a dragon from the tessellated paper. Or you may just enjoy the tessellation itself. Personally, I like the process of folding tessellations, and I am fascinated by the patterns, and find them quite beautiful.
